But if you have actually done your research, you 'd recognize there are 2 kinds of waterproofing: interior and exterior. It can get confusing what they both mean, which one's a much better financial investment, and what will actually keep the water out. Don't fret, we placed with each other this blog site to quickly specify both approaches for you and review the pros and cons of each.


Exterior waterproofing is a waterproofing method that involves sealing your home from the exterior. The foundation wall surfaces are after that cleansed, sealed, and covered with a water-proof membrane layer or sealant.

The largest advantage of outside waterproofing is that it protects against water from entering your basement in the first location. Groundwater and heavy rains can seep in via the splits in your foundation, so outside waterproofing can avoid water from entering your home.

It's a more involved process that requires digging up your lawn, which is expensive and time-consuming. Outside waterproofing involves getting rid of whatever surrounding your home, including verandas, driveways, walkways, landscape design, air conditioning devices, decks, and more. If any of the job was done incorrectly and water is still entering your cellar, there isn't much you can do to correct or repair it.


Inside basement waterproofing entails waterproofing from the inside. Any type of water that leaks into your cellar is rerouted before it touches your flooring. It's sort of like using a raincoat under your clothes. It entails have a peek at this website 2 things: a water drain track and a sump pump. It works by securing the within of your basement walls and floorings so water that attempts to get in is carried out through a sump pump.


It's an effective technique to waterproof your basement. The disadvantage of indoor basement waterproofing mostly has to do with the setup procedure. This approach requires kept things, furniture, and built-in shelving or closets to be relocated from touching the basement walls. And during setup, your cellar can't be utilized. The largest difference in between both approaches is this: Outside waterproofing is a preventative service and indoor waterproofing is a corrective remedy.

To conclude, exterior and indoor cellar waterproofing are both efficient methods of safeguarding your home from water damage. Outside waterproofing develops a barrier that avoids water from entering your home, while indoor waterproofing reroutes water that does enter your home. And it is essential to note that outside waterproofing is a pricey and disruptive installation procedure when contrasted to interior waterproofing.
